Subject: [bug#71111] [PATCH 0/1] services: home: Use pairs instead of lists.
Date: Wed, 22 May 2024 14:02:26 +0400
After rewriting from car/cdr to match-lambda in v2 of this patch:
https://yhetil.org/guix-patches/3394b0b51f6a5a608ebcfb7a63fdc34e52fe928e.1711046203.git.richard <at> freakingpenguin.com/

the format changed from pairs to lists, I didn't noticed this nuance
during review because the documentation still says that service should
be configured and extended with pairs.  Also, pairs are more
apropriate data type here.  And this match-lambda rewrite will break
downstream RDE user's setups after migrating to upstreamed version of
service.

That's why I propose to go back to pairs.
